Utiliser Texte RTF

Signaler
Messages postés
2
Date d'inscription
mercredi 26 avril 2006
Statut
Membre
Dernière intervention
23 août 2006
-
Messages postés
2
Date d'inscription
mercredi 26 avril 2006
Statut
Membre
Dernière intervention
23 août 2006
-
Bonjour,

Quelqu'un pourrait t'il me dire comment extraire le contenu d'un texte RTF  ? Concrètement, j'ai une base Access avec un lien ODBC sur une table SQL Server dont un champ contient du texte au format riche (RTF)

Voici un exemple de données au format RTF :

{\rtf1\ansi\ansicpg1252\deff0{\fonttbl{\f0\fnil Arial;}}{\colortbl ;\red0\green0\blue0;}
{\*\generator Riched20 5.40.11.2212;}\viewkind4\uc1\pard\cf1\lang1036\f0\fs16 TOTOTITI\par \par }

Existe t'il une fonction pour extraire TOTOTITIen oubliant toute la mise en forme avant et après ?

Merci par avance,

2 réponses

Messages postés
7741
Date d'inscription
mercredi 1 septembre 2004
Statut
Membre
Dernière intervention
24 septembre 2014
41
Il n'est pas nécessaire de poster plusieur fois.

Tu met ton texte dans une richtextbox, dans la propriété TextRtf.
Ensuite tu récupère le texte sans mise en forme normalement par la propriété Text.

---- Sevyc64  (alias Casy) ----<hr size="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#
Messages postés
2
Date d'inscription
mercredi 26 avril 2006
Statut
Membre
Dernière intervention
23 août 2006

Désolé pour avoir écris les trois memes messages, mais lorsque j'ai posté les deux premières fois je suis tombé sur une URL Erreur, j'ai donc insisté...

Bref,
 
Merci pour ta réponse, mais le richtextbox ne permet pas d'automatiser une procédure. En faisaint, par exemple un module qui aurait traité chaque enregistrement de la table et qui aurait extrait le texte brut du champ contenant les données au format RTF

Avez vous d'autres propositions, ou par l'utilisation plus poussée du richtextbox peut on faire ça ? Merci